

William Keith Wallace, 91, died peacefully at home on June 15, 2026. He was born June 29, 1934, near the oil fields of Pawnee Oklahoma to Herbert and Violet Wallace. Bill grew up in Pine Grove, West Virginia, where he built the steady foundation of a life marked by devotion, faithfulness, and thoughtful care for those around him. After attending primary school in the one-room Mobley schoolhouse, he graduated from Pine Grove High School. Bill was the first in his family to attend college, studying at the University of West Virginia from 1952 through 1959. This included serving in the Marine Corps from 1954 – 1958 and ultimately receiving a Bachelor’s Degree in Mechanical Engineering.
Bill dedicated his 36-year working life to Chicago Pneumatic (CP) Tool Company working as an engineer filling development and management roles at the Utica, New York and Rock Hill, South Carolina locations. With a wise and attentive mind for design, he created many tools and earned several patents—work that reflected both his skill and the quiet diligence he brought to every responsibility.
On July 17, 1960, Bill married Mary Hudak. They lived together in Barneveld, New York for 39 years where they raised two sons before moving to Carolina Shores, North Carolina in 1999. In retirement, Bill enjoyed golfing, traveling, and relaxing, but what he treasured most was time with family—especially the moments shared with his grandchildren, where his beloved presence and steady guidance were felt most deeply.
